Pengaruh Sales Growth, Likuiditas Dan Ukuran Perusahaan Terhadap Financial Distress Lise Roswati Rochendi; Nuryaman Nuryaman

Abstract

The company's goal other than making a profit is to be able to continue to grow and survive in the competition, but the emergence of internal threats such as financial difficulties can hinder the achievement of the company's goals. Therefore, management is required to perform optimally in the company's activities, especially financial in order to avoid financial distress. This study aims to determine the effect of sales growth, liquidity and firm size on financial distress. The population of this study are transportation compan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ange for the 2016-2021 period. The sample selection using purposive sampling technique, the sample obtained is 16 companies with a 6 year observation period so that there are 96 research data. The type of data used in this research is quantitative data. The data collection method uses secondary data in the form of financial reports. The method used is descriptive and verification method using a quantitative approach. The data analysis technique used in this research is logistic regression analysis, coefficient of determination, partial significance test using Eviews version 9. The results show that sales growth has no effect on financial distress, liquidity has no effect on financial distress and the size of the company has a negative effect on financial distress.
Beyond Numbers: Beyond Numbers: Exploring Factors Influencing Company Value In Indonesian Consumer Goods (2018-2022) Ahmad, Darmawel; Nuryaman, Nuryaman

Abstract

This study analyzed Indonesian consumer goods' business value determinants (2018-2022) using numerical methods, focusing on the impact of key variables like debt-to-equity ratio, total asset turnover, logarithm of assets, and return on equity. The research investigated the influence of these factors on companies listed on the Indonesian Stock Exchange, revealing significant effects of debt-to-equity ratio and total asset turnover on return on equity and subsequently on price-to-book value. The logarithm of assets directly affected return on equity but had no impact on price-to-book value. Regression analysis, measured by R-Square and Q-Square values, demonstrated the variables' impact on cost-to-book value and return on equity. The study confirmed that financial leverage and asset utilization significantly affect enterprise value, highlighting the importance of effective financial management in optimizing investment returns in Indonesia's consumer goods sector.
